看看有沒有人遇到過com.mysql.jdbc.MysqlDataTruncation: Data truncation: Truncated incorrect DOUBLE 就是因為上面一句SQL語句,害我調了大半天,結果查來查去只是因為上面SQL語句寫成了and,正確 ...
在使用mybatis的 Update注解的時候,報了一個這樣的錯 調用的方法如下: 在網上看了各種解決辦法,有說是set語句中逗號誤寫成了and導致的,樓主遇到的不是這個情況 看上面的報錯,以為是數據庫中id字段 長度VARCHAR 為 c c fb 的這條數據長度過長導致的。於是將這條數據的id改為 ,一執行,發現執行成功。樓主便得意的以為是id過長導致的。 但心里也奇怪數據庫明明可以放 位,為 ...
2018-04-15 18:59 1 14826 推薦指數:
看看有沒有人遇到過com.mysql.jdbc.MysqlDataTruncation: Data truncation: Truncated incorrect DOUBLE 就是因為上面一句SQL語句,害我調了大半天,結果查來查去只是因為上面SQL語句寫成了and,正確 ...
com.mysql.cj.jdbc.exceptions.MysqlDataTruncation: Data truncation: Truncated incorrect DOUBLE value: '張三'異常的解決辦法 錯誤 ...
總結寫在前面, 總結: 當Java通過jdbc鏈接mysql插入中文時,要保證程序可以正常執行,而且插入的中文不會亂碼, mysql服務器端,對數據表(不是數據庫)的編碼設置,要保證是支持中文的,例如gbk, gb2312, utf-8 jdbc的連接配置,要開啟 ...
getTime確定你這里返回的類型是java.sql.Time,如果用的是date請用setDate 同樣,要求的類型是java.sql.Date而不是java.util.Date Java. ...
原因: 第一,方法重載問題 第二,字符超過了長度 第三,就是編碼問題(重要,容易被人忽略) 有兩種可能,第一種就是數據庫編碼,另外一種數據庫編碼沒問題,文件編 ...
要插入的數據超出了數據庫中的數據能存儲的長度.所以才會有這種錯誤, 可以給該字段換一種數據類型.使用bigint. ...
數據庫配置環境:Ubuntu->MySQL5.7 mybatis在插入時間Date字段的時候出現下面錯誤: 嘗試了網上很多種解決時間插入問題的方法;比如將java.util.Date轉化為java.sql.Date再插入,比如更新MySQL ...
遇到這種問題的原因有兩種 1、可能是表中設置的字符集與你想要插入的字符集不相同。 解決方法: (1)修改數據庫默認編碼ALTER DATABASE `test` DEFA ...